15
X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011) Da Pesquisa em Engenharia de Software à Melhoria da Qualidade de Software no Brasil Autores: Marcos Kalinowski (COPPE/UFRJ), Gleison Santos (PPGI - UNIRIO) , Rafael Prikladnicki (PUCRS), Ana Regina Rocha (COPPE/UFRJ), Kival Chaves Weber (SOFTEX) José Antonio Antonioni (SOFTEX) 1

Da Pesquisa em Engenharia de Software à Melhoria da Qualidade

Embed Size (px)

Citation preview

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Da Pesquisa em Engenharia de Software à Melhoria da

Qualidade de Software no Brasil

Autores: Marcos Kalinowski (COPPE/UFRJ), Gleison Santos (PPGI - UNIRIO), Rafael Prikladnicki (PUCRS), Ana Regina Rocha (COPPE/UFRJ), Kival Chaves Weber (SOFTEX) José Antonio Antonioni (SOFTEX)

1

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011) 2

Introdução • Objetivos do artigo:

– Apresentar o papel da Academia na criação e transferência de conhecimento de Engenharia de Software para a Indústria;

– Apresentar o MPS.BR nesta transferência; – Apresentar o papel do SBES neste

processo.

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011) 3

Introdução • Engenharia de Software é uma disciplina

relacionada com a solução de problemas práticos da indústria de software.

• A Academia tem um papel fundamental – na descoberta de soluções para atender

necessidades e anseios da indústria; – na melhoria da qualidade dos software

produzidos;

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011) 4

Preocupações da Engenharia de Software

Qualidade do processo

Qualidade do produto

Necessidades do Negócio

problemas no processo provavelmente geram defeitos

no produto

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

SBES e Engenharia de Software

5

SBES$25$anos$

Comunidade$de$Engenharia$de$So4ware$

Fóruns$Específicos$$

WQS$>>$SBQS$

Massa$Crí=ca$ConhecimentoQualificação$

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Mobilização Conjunta da Hélice-Tripla

6

Academia(

Indústria(Governo(

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Interação Indústria-Academia e MPS.BR

7

Academia

MPS.BR Empresas

Boas práticas de Engenharia de Software Temas de

Pesquisa Necessidades da Indústria

Uso

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Coordenação do MPS.BR

8

SOFTEX

Equipe Técnica do Modelo (ETM)

(academia, governo, empresas)

Fórum de Credenciamento e

Controle (FCC) (academia, governo, empresas)

Comissão de Ética do Programa

(CEP)

Coordenação do Programa MPS.BR

(SOFTEX)

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Estrutura do Modelo MPS

9

Modelo MPS

Modelo de Negócio (MN-MPS)

Documentos do

Programa

Modelo de Avaliação (MA-MPS)

Guia de Avaliação

Modelo de Referência (MR-MPS)

Guia de Aquisição Guia Geral

Guia de Implementação

ISO/IEC 12207 Definição Processos e Resultados Esperados

CMMI-DEV Complementação

Processos

ISO/IEC 15504 Definição Capacidade Processos

e Requisitos de Avaliação

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Níveis de Maturidade MPS

10

Gerenciado Quantitativamente

Parcialmente Gerenciado

Gerenciado

Parcialmente Definido

Largamente Definido

Definido

Em Otimização

Gerência de Projetos - GPR (evolução)

Gerência de Requisitos - GRE Gerência de Projetos - GPR

Definição do Processo Organizacional – DFP Avaliação e Melhoria do Processo Organizacional – AMP / Gerência de Reutilização - GRU Gerência de Recursos Humanos – GRH Gerência de Projetos - GPR (evolução)

Medição - MED / Gerência de Configuração - GCO Aquisição - AQU / Garantia da Qualidade - GQA Gerência de Portfólio de Projetos - GPP

Desenvolvimento de Requisitos - DRE Projeto e Construção do Produto - PCP Integração do Produto - ITP Verificação - VER / Validação - VAL

Gerência de Decisões - GDE Desenvolvimento para Reutilização - DRU Gerência de Riscos - GRI

G

(sem processos específicos)

F

E

D

C

B

A

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

iMPS – Indicadores de Desempenho

11

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

iMPS – Indicadores de Desempenho

12

92% das empresas estão parcialmente ou totalmente satisfeitas com o MPS

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

IIs, IAs, Empresas Avaliadas

13

Instituições Implementadoras

18 empresas 12 ligadas a universidades

Instituições Avaliadoras

12 empresas 8 ligadas a universidades

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Considerações Finais •  O SBES tornou possível o amadurecimento da

comunidade acadêmica brasileira de Engenharia de Software e também deu origem à iniciativa de transferência de conhecimento descrita neste artigo.

•  O MPS.BR está alinhado aos objetivos estratégicos do governo e tem forte participação da academia.

•  Resultados da indústria são expressivos. •  A academia também se beneficia da interação com

a indústria. •  O Programa MPS.BR é patrocinado por: MCT,

FINEP, SEBRAE, BID •  Convite ao WAMPS 2011

14

XXV Simpósio Brasileiro de Engenharia de Software (SBES 2011)

Da Pesquisa em Engenharia de Software à Melhoria da

Qualidade de Software no Brasil

Autores: Marcos Kalinowski (COPPE/UFRJ), Gleison Santos (PPGI - UNIRIO), Rafael Prikladnicki (PUCRS), Ana Regina Rocha (COPPE/UFRJ), Kival Chaves Weber (SOFTEX) José Antonio Antonioni (SOFTEX)

15

Informações sobre o MPS.BR: www.softex.br/mpsbr